Terminator: Dark Fate (2019)
Thank you, James Cameron!
Finally worth watching and raising interest again for the Terminator series. It's been a while since there was a decent Terminator movie after Terminator 2. Plot could be more enhanced but the action made up for it. All cast members did at least decently for their roles. The main characters carried the movie equally well making a well-rounded effort. Typical humor here and there from Arnold but nothing corny or distasteful.
Actions overall kept me staying with the movie and interested in the plot. Very consistent transitions between plot and actions to procide entertainment.
Graphics were good and believable, compared to The Gemini Man and Annabelle Comes Home. Go see it!
The Current War (2017)
enLIGHTening Movie about Mankind's Inventions...
Overall appropriate movie for a family or group setting but not a date movie, unless the thirst yearns for specialized historical knowledge and high quality acting. Benedict Cumberbatch, Michael Shannon, Nicholas Hoult and Tom Holland lit up this movie! Very strong cast with engaging moments and great cinematography. No corny lines here!
The plot was progressive with a good balance of all the main components needed to be highlighted in this historical piece. There's not too much "nerd jargon" that the viewer would completely lose out the entertainment value of the premises of the movie. Assuming the breakthroughs/inventions were ALL true by their own inventors, one would learn a little more about each inventor besides his greatest achievements.
Great movie! Progressive plot with little to no twists to distract viewer.
Countdown (2019)
A one-time view for me at best...
Overall okay movie for me in the Horror genre. "Scary Stories to Tell in the Dark" was my most memorable one for 2019 so far. Here are some qualities worth mentioning:
- decent cast and okay acting
- cinematography adequate with okay graphics/visual effects
- no annoying corny lines or one-liners
- good use of current technology to apply to plot
Something not up to standards:
- typical scare tactics from horror movies through the use of random loud sound
- poor integration of current technology and demons/spirits in the plot
- plot has noticeable plot holes leading to questions and discontinuity
Definitely a one-time view for me.
Black and Blue (2019)
Disregard the super low reviews! Not fair...
I didn't know why this movie had a low review. Went to watch it then thought, "Ohhh, now I see why." The low reviews probably come biased with the bad publicity for law enforcement lately. This movie portrayed some issues that happen to relate to law enforcement but sticks to its own plot for the sake of its own ENTERTAINMENT VALUE instead of political statement.
Good cast. Good acting. Suspenseful. More substance than Gemini Man. Straight up linear movie without offensive hidden agendas. The movie definitely deserves more praise. Come on, people!
